Étude technique jouet connecté

pour smartphone et tablette

L’idée n’est pas nouvelle, sur la Wii, il existait un jeu pour tous petits. On dissimulait une Wii-Mote dans une peluche et utilisait cette dernière pour interagir dans le jeu.

Le projet était de développer une ANE (Adobe Native Extension), un pont logiciel entre un tag iBeacon muni d’un accéléromètre (6 DoF) et une application sur tablette développée en as3 et AIR for iOS.

Le tag BLE est composé d’un module Bluetooth 4, un CC2541 de Texas Instrument et d’un MPU6050 (6DoF – accéléromètre et gyroscope) pour une dimension de 30 × 30 × 7 mm, plus une pile bouton CR2032. Le tag dispose également d’une sonde de température et de pression.

L’ANE a été développée en Objective C par Umxprime (Maxime Chapelet) et permet de se connecter au module et de lire les valeurs d’orientation du mpu (le MPU propose en sortie un algorithme Fusion qui interprète les valeurs de l’accéléro et du gyroscope en une valeur d’orientation, gîte et roulis).

as3, Objective C (@Umxprime)